He will not fight with me, Domitius?

 

Mark Antony     

Antony and Cleopatra       Act IV, Scene iii, Line 1

 

Antony is talking to his right-hand man Domitius Enobarbus. They’re discussing the fact that Caesar refuses to fight with Antony. Why should he when he stands a chance of losing to Antony; especially since Caesar’s army is sure to defeat Antony’s. Caesar is no dummy.
